What Defines a Sash Window?
A sash window is made up of one or more movable panels, or "sashes," that form a frame to hold panes of glass. Traditionally, these sashes slide vertically, supported by a system of hidden weights, pulley-blocks, and cords (in older models) or contemporary spring balances.
The configuration of these windows is vital. In a "single-hung" window, just the bottom sash relocations while the top sash remains set. In a "double-hung" window, both the top and bottom sashes are operable. The ability to reduce the leading sash is especially valued for its role in natural convection and air flow.

While many individuals primarily communicate with the bottom sash, the leading sash plays an important role in the performance of a well-designed home. Here are a number of reasons that the top sash is considered an essential design element:
1. Superior Ventilation
The physics of air movement makes the top sash important for cooling. As warm air rises, it accumulates near the ceiling. By reducing the top sash and raising the bottom sash at the same time, a convection current is created. Cool air enters through the bottom, while the hot, stagnant air is pushed out through the top. This supplies a natural option to air conditioning.
2. Improved Security and Privacy
For ground-floor rooms or bed rooms, opening the top sash permits fresh air while keeping the bottom sash securely closed and locked. This lessens the threat of trespassers entering through an open window and avoids passersby from looking directly into the home.
3. Safety for Children and Pets
Homeowner with kids often prefer leading sash ventilation. By keeping the bottom sash closed and only using the upper opening, there is a significantly lowered threat of unintentional falls, offering comfort without compromising airflow.

Modern engineering has actually resolved much of the standard "discomfort points" connected with sash windows, such as rattling, sticking, and poor insulation.

Frequently Asked Questions (FAQ)1. Do I need preparing authorization to change sash windows?
If the property is in a Conservation Area or is a Listed Building, planning permission or "Listed Building Consent" is normally needed. The majority of authorities need "like-for-like" replacements, indicating the products and glazing bar patterns should match the originals.
2. Are modern-day sash windows energy efficient?
Yes. Modern sash windows utilize innovative weather condition stripping and energy-efficient double glazing. They can attain high "A" scores for energy efficiency, equivalent to modern-day casement windows.
3. How do I stop my sash windows from rattling?
Rattling is normally triggered by a gap between the sash and the frame. Installing a Professional Sash Window Fitters draft-proofing system, that includes brush stacks and provider strips, will fill these spaces and silence the windows while enhancing insulation.
4. Can uPVC sash windows look as great as wood?
High-end uPVC sash windows now feature "timber-effect" grain finishes and mechanical joints (instead of welded plastic corners) that closely imitate the look of real wood. From a range, they are typically indistinguishable from traditional wood.
5. The length of time should a set of timber sash windows last?
With correct upkeep-- specifically repainting every 5 to 8 years-- wood timber sash windows can easily last 60 to 100 years. This makes them a more sustainable and long-term option than numerous artificial options.
